Mom's Zucchini Bread

3 Cups all purpose flour
1 teaspoon each of salt, baking soda and baking powder
3 teaspoons ground cinnamon
3 eggs
1 Cup vegetable oil (I used unsweetened apple sauce)
2 1/4 cups white sugar
3 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 Cups grated zucchini
1 Cup chopped walnuts (oops, I only had pecans)

Grease and flour two 8 x 4 inch pans.  Preheat oven to 325°.

Sift flour, salt, baking powder, soda and cinnamon together in a bowl.

Beat eggs, oil, vanilla and sugar together in a large bowl.  Add sifted ingredients to the creamed mixture and beat well.  Stir in zucchini and nuts until well combined.  Pour batter into prepared pans.

Bake for 40-60 minutes, or until tester inserted in the center comes out clean.  Cool in pan on rack for 20 minutes.  Remove bread from pan, and completely cool.
